Truth is, we don't know from newspaper stories what the actual complaint alleges. We don't know if the allegations are accurate. And above all, we don't know what legal rights either of them has to the Runaways name. IOW, Jackie could be blocking approval of a movie, but maybe she has the legal right to. For all we know, Kim Fowley could be claiming ownership too.

From Jackie's MySpace page: AUGUST 30, 2009: To those of you who have asked about the complaint that Joan Jett, Kenny Laguna and Blackheart Records have filed against me in a New York court, I will just say thank you for your support and concern. I'm not going to comment on pending litigation -- just know that the complaint ALLEGES certain things. It doesn't mean that they are true. Also, apparently there is someone posting on other sites under my name. It isn't me. There is a lot of erroneous information floating around out there and unfortunately is is upsetting to Runaways fans. If I have anything to say about the Runaways, I will say it here.
